Song & Call Comparison

Bare-legged Swiftlet

さえずり

High thin twittering; 'tsit-tsit' over New Guinea lowlands; echolocation clicks in cave roosts; calls weakly in flight; colonial nester producing soft flock chattering

White-collared Swift

さえずり

Loud, screaming 'shreee-shreee'; powerful screeching trill; calls from large flocks over mountains; very audible; one of the loudest Neotropical swifts; alarm a harsh rattle

Geographic Range & Migration

Bare-legged Swiftlet

Found in lowland New Guinea and adjacent islands. Resident in lowland rainforest and forest edge. Little-known Papuan endemic.

White-collared Swift

Found from Mexico south through Central America to South America east of the Andes, reaching Bolivia and southern Brazil. Often in large flocks.

How to Tell Them Apart

Bare-legged Swiftlet

羽毛

Small; dark grey-brown upperparts; pale rump band; underparts whitish-grey; forked tail; bare unfeathered tarsi distinctive among swiftlets; New Guinea lowland cave-nesting species; bare legs visible at nest but rarely field-observable.

White-collared Swift

羽毛
